## SFTP Drop Tuning

Partner files land in the Tidewell drop and are polled on a fixed interval. Late or partial uploads retry automatically; escalate only after retries are exhausted. Do not change timings without engineering sign-off. Current polling and retry settings are shown below.

tuning table, yajog-yahof:
BUDGETS = {
    "lamvan": 303,
    "wenox": 460,
    "fenvan": 525,
}

Handover Note — Licensing Dispute, for Branch Managers

From: Director Hale Morrow. To: Director Ines Varga.

The dispute with Kestrel Foundry over the Aldervane toolkit license remains unresolved. Counsel advises continued use under the existing terms while negotiations proceed. Branch managers should route any vendor inquiries to legal and avoid committing to renewal timelines. Settlement talks resume next month. The confidential position we intend to take is stated below.

internal memo for bajep-kaduf: Ulaokax Works is in early talks to buy Olidorek Group for about $36.1 million. The Kasax launch date is November 22, and nothing goes to the press before then.

Any pull request touching the serializer requires two approvals: one from the payroll domain group and one from platform. Reviewers must confirm that rounding behavior is unchanged, that the legacy writer remains behind the compatibility flag until the Harrowgate migration completes, and that golden-file tests were regenerated deliberately, not blindly. Final sign-off authority for format changes rests with the individual listed below.

named custodian: Brivan Eliath Quenox Frador

### RestockPilot: Release Prerequisites

Before cutting a release, confirm that the RestockPilot planner can reach the SnackGrid inventory service, since the build pipeline runs an integration smoke test against staging during packaging. A failed handshake here blocks the release tag, so verify credentials first. The pipeline reads its staging credential from the deploy config; for reference and manual verification, the current key appears below.

service key, tajof-fawip: vxb4-JNOz